| Notas: | Handstamped Japanese Occupation Notes: The Philippine organization JAPWANCAP, Inc. (Japanese War Notes Claimants Association of the Philippines), made a very serious attempt in 1967 to obtain funds from the United States for redemption of millions of Pesos in Japanese occupation currency.
